Newborn children:
Correct answer: B. can follow a moving object with their eyes
- A. have limited sense abilities at birth and cannot feel pain at all
- B. can follow a moving object with their eyes
- C. cannot learn and must depend on the adaptive reflexes in order to survive
- D. have extremely poor hearing
Explanation
Newborns can track a slowly moving object with their eyes, although their visual abilities are still immature. They can also feel pain, hear reasonably well, and begin learning from experience.
